Keywords: Inkjet Printer Epson Message-ID: <12349@ur-cc.UUCP> Date: 21 Feb 91 16:08:53 GMT References: <4509@syma.sussex.ac.uk> Sender: news@uhura.cc.rochester.edu Organization: University of Rochester - Rochester, New York Lines: 13 The HP Deskjet 500 is a fine inkjet; costs $500 discounted; and will print on regular office paper (high-grade copier paper is best). It will NOT do continuous forms, though. It will do #10 envelopes. Nice and quiet, with 300 dpi resolution. New non-smearing ink. You can get an Epson emulation cartridge for it ($55 at CompuAdd). Courier 10, 16, and 20; Letter Gothic 12; and Times Roman 12 are built in. Two-year warranty. Ink cartridges cost less than $15 each (CompuAdd). If you use UltraScript PC; Publisher's PowerPak; or other scaleable font software package, the results can be impressive. P.S. - I have one.
